PS7 Turns Achievements into Lasting Gaming Memories
Progression gives players a sense that their time inside games has meaning. Completing a difficult challenge, discovering a hidden area, mastering a mechanic, or finishing a long adventure can become a memorable part of someone's gaming history. PS7 can extend that feeling beyond individual titles by creating a platform profile where achievements, milestones, and completed experiences remain visible. PS7 can help players see how different games have contributed to their broader journey. Rather than treating each achievement as an isolated notification, the platform can present accomplishments as pieces of a larger personal history.
Achievement discovery can encourage players to explore parts of games they might otherwise overlook. PS7 can highlight unfinished milestones, optional challenges, or unusual objectives that offer different ways to engage with familiar titles. PS7 can make these suggestions available without turning completion into an obligation. Some players enjoy collecting every achievement, while others prefer to focus only on goals that match their interests. A flexible achievement system can support both styles and let players decide what makes progression meaningful.
Social sharing can give accomplishments another dimension. PS7 can allow players to showcase selected milestones to friends, celebrate difficult achievements, or discuss strategies for completing challenging objectives. PS7 can also connect achievements with community events where players work toward shared goals. These interactions can create friendly motivation without requiring intense competition. A player may feel proud of completing a difficult section, while friends can respond with encouragement or curiosity about how it was achieved.
Progression can also become a form of personal reflection. PS7 can show how a player's interests have shifted through different games, genres, communities, and periods of activity. A profile might reveal a long history with cooperative adventures followed by a recent interest in narrative games. PS7 can turn these changes into a record that players can revisit. This makes achievement systems valuable even when there is no immediate reward. The profile becomes a snapshot of personal gaming culture.
Accessibility remains important within progression systems. PS7 can make achievement information readable, easy to navigate, and available across different screen sizes. PS7 can provide clear descriptions so players understand what each milestone represents. Players should be able to explore achievement histories without dealing with cluttered interfaces or confusing menus. Good presentation allows accomplishments to remain enjoyable rather than turning them into another complicated section of a platform.
PS7 can ultimately make progression feel like storytelling. Every achievement can represent a moment of exploration, persistence, creativity, teamwork, or skill. PS7 can bring those moments together into a profile that reflects individual gaming history. Players can celebrate what they have completed while still finding reasons to explore something new. This approach gives achievements a purpose beyond numbers: they become reminders of experiences that helped shape a player's relationship with games.
